Your Role:

The Warehouse Operator 3 – Split Shift at MilliporeSigma will be responsible for the receipt of all incoming materials, supplies, equipment and returned goods. You will also route or deliver material to storage or production areas and safely operate a variety of materialhandling equipment, which may include narrow aisles, and wire guided “Operator up” machines.Job duties include:

  • Shift hours: Monday – Friday, 8:00am – 4:30pm
  • Manage the complete receiving process for all incoming materials, supplies, equipment, and returned goods, encompassing unloading trailers using power equipment, verifying freight and signing bills of lading, sorting, inspecting, and recording receipt in the system (e.g., SAP), followed by final put-away.
  • Put product away using scanner or computer system
  • Resolve Product issues with Procurement
  • Checks chemicals, catalog number, lot number, special requests information, unit size and weights against order documentation found in packing or receiving instructions
  • Manage outbound shipments by scheduling dock appointments with carriers and executing the packing process according to established procedures and instructions, ensuring compliance with hazardous materials regulations through proper packing, labeling, and marking.
  • Accurately select and stage product with use of power equipment
  • Manage material handling operations including accurate selection and staging of product (using power equipment) and selection/put away using specialized narrow aisle/wire guided/operator up machines; maintain order records; and communicate/resolve discrepancies with internal customers.
  • Deliver product to on-site customers and put product into storage areas
  • Manage inventory accuracy through necessary system adjustments and moves; communicate discrepancies and product issues to Procurement; and liaison with Customer Interface Departments on shipping issues and expedite priorities.
  • Conduct inventory audits (counting and verifying actual location with system), manage the disposition of defective material (removing and shipping to vendors), and perform other miscellaneous duties and tasks as assigned.
